基本信息

词语:菌蛋白

繁体:菌蛋白

拼音:jūn dàn bái

英语翻译

【化】 mycoprotein
【医】 mycoprotein

分词翻译

菌的英语翻译:

bacterium; fungus; mushroom
【医】 bacterio-

蛋白的英语翻译:

albumen; egg white; glair; protein; white
【医】 proteid; protein; proteinum; protide
